Granby Junior School

Granby Junior School is a large, happy and popular school in Ilkeston. The pupils, staff and Governors are looking to appoint a dynamic, enthusiastic, fun, hardworking and motivated Midday Supervisor.

The Successful Candidate

The successful candidate will be committed to ensuring our children have access to a wide variety of activities during lunchtime.

Our children are fantastic; being polite, hardworking and fun to be with. We encourage self-confidence, independence and enjoy celebrating success.

What We Can Offer

  • An experienced, friendly and supportive staff team.
  • Well behaved pupils who enjoy being at school.
  • A school that values the social and emotional development of children.
  • An inclusive school that embraces the wider curriculum and outdoor learning.
  • CPD and training opportunities.
  • The opportunity to make a real difference to the lives of our children and the wider community.
